Service Oriented Architecture

A Service Oriented Architecture (SOA) is set of principles defining an architecture (that is loosely coupled and comprised of service providers and service consumers) which interacts according to a negotiated contract or interface. These services provide the Interfaces to Applications in the IT landscape. The primary goal of SOA is to expose application functions in a standardised way so that they can be leveraged across multiple projects. This approach greatly reduces the time, effort and cost it takes to maintain and expand solutions to meet business needs. SOA is not an off-the-shelf technology; rather, it is a way of architecting and organising IT infrastructure and business functionality.

SOA promotes loose coupling of software, resulting in services that are easier to integrate as they utilise lower-cost tools and have standards-based exchange formats and interface.

SOA Attributes:

• Functionality is organised as a set of modular, reusable shared services
• Services have well-defined interfaces and encapsulate key business processes
• Customer facing solutions serve as customised views of these services for different segments, and can access these shared services as needed.
• The reusable shared services are built without making any assumptions of who (portal or another service) will consume these services

Benefits of SOA:

• Agility to collaborate – SOA provides the ease of sharing information securely with partners and stakeholders by presenting a standard coarse grained service which any authorised business partner can use.
• Reduction of cost – SOA primitives are standards-based. For example, WSDL, SAML, SOAP & UDDI, provides a modular architecture, thereby enabling sharing and reuse of services.
• Improvement in efficiency – SOA promotes a modular enterprise, promising a high degree of reusability of business services, ensuring consistency.

Summary:

Although organisations vary in their purpose, size, structure and community, their underlying IT systems presents a broad set of common concerns and requirements. Examples include the need to align IT with the organisations missions and objectives, IT governance, providing competencies and abilities to share information and collaborate effectively and efficiently.

With SOA, companies have the potential to enable a much higher degree of business agility by transforming the current enterprise IT into a service-driven delivery model.

MDIS

Founded in 1956, the Management Development Institute of Singapore (MDIS) is Singapore’s oldest not-for-profit professional institute for lifelong learning. MDIS has two main subsidiaries: Management Development Institute of Singapore Pte Ltd which oversees its Singapore academic operations, and MDIS International Pte Ltd which focuses on MDIS’ globalisation strategy. MDIS offers internationally-accredited courses in Business and Management, Engineering, Fashion, Health and Nursing, Information Technology, Languages and Education, Life Sciences, Media and Communications, Psychology, Tourism and Hospitality Management, and Safety and Environmental Management. These programmes are offered in collaboration with renowned universities in the United Kingdom.

Share
Published by
MDIS

Recent Posts

Take Off to Success with the MDIS Open House 2024

Success seems hard to achieve, but it is not. Success requires a mix of hard…

4 months ago

Reimagining Executive Leadership In A VUCA World

It is no secret that leaders face incredibly dynamic challenges in today’s Volatile, Uncertain, Complex…

4 months ago

How has Engineering Evolved to Tackle Sustainability Issues?

Engineers are known for making magic happen. Leveraging innovation, creativity and knowledge earned through training…

4 months ago

MDIS X University of Roehampton London Graduation Ceremony 2023 Highlights

The MDIS-University of Roehampton graduation ceremony marked a two-year partnership celebration, honouring 56 graduates, with…

5 months ago

Cyber Security Courses in Singapore – MDIS

Scope of Studying Cyber Security Courses in Singapore In a world where digital connections rule,…

5 months ago

What’s next after GCE O-Levels?

The completion of your GCE O-Level marks the end of a chapter and the opening…

5 months ago